Japanese Bread Recipe
One among the most popular sorts of Japanese bread is Shokupan, often known as Japanese milk bread. Here's an easy recipe to make this delightful bread at your home:

Elements:

2 1/two cups bread flour
one/4 cup sugar
1 teaspoon salt
2 teaspoons prompt yeast
1/two cup full milk
1/4 cup significant cream
1 substantial egg
two t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
Directions:

In a very bowl, combine the bread flour, sugar, salt, and yeast.
In the different bowl, mix the milk, weighty product, and egg.
Incorporate the wet and dry components, then knead the dough right until It is easy and elastic.
Insert the butter and continue kneading until finally totally incorporated.
Allow the dough rise in the heat position until doubled in size.
Punch down the dough, shape it into a loaf, and location it within a greased loaf pan.
Permit it rise yet again right until doubled.
Bake at 350°File (a hundred seventy five°C) for about 30 minutes, or until finally golden brown.
This Shokupan recipe yields a loaf by using a pillowy texture and a little sweet taste, ideal for sandwiches or toast.

Japanese Bread Crumbs (Panko)
Panko, or Japanese bread crumbs, are coarser and lighter than classic bread crumbs. They supply a crispy coating for fried foods like tempura and tonkatsu (breaded pork cutlet). Panko is made out of crustless bread, that's baked then ground into big flakes.

Japanese Bread Flour
The secret into the comfortable and airy texture of Japanese bread lies inside the flour. Japanese bread flour is often milled to a finer regularity and it has the next protein content material, which will help achieve that signature fluffiness.

Japanese Bread Varieties
You will discover numerous varieties of Japanese bread, Just about every with its one of a kind characteristics:

Shokupan: Gentle, white milk bread typically employed for sandwiches.
Melonpan: Sweet bread by using a cookie crust resembling a melon.
Anpan: Sweet roll full of crimson bean paste.
Curry Pan: Bread full of curry and coated in breadcrumbs just before frying.
Katsu Sando: A sandwich produced with breaded cutlet, generally pork or hen.

Bread Japanese Translation
The word for bread in Japanese is "パン" (pan), which can be derived with the Portuguese term "pão," reflecting Japan's historic interactions with Portuguese traders.

Japanese Bread King Television set Series Plot
"Yakitate!! Japan," also called "The King of Bread," is often a Japanese manga and anime collection a few youthful baker named Kazuma Azuma who strives to develop the last word Japanese bread. The plot follows his journey via many baking competitions.
